As I mentioned in my previous post, working on your grayscale values is probably the most important thing, especially when sketching out thumbnails that you can actually use as references for more polished work.  However, it can be a little frustrating to work with values if you don't have a solid idea of how to use dark and light colours.

So, I put together a little exercise file (PSD) called 'Thumbnails practice sheet' which I use to flush out ideas quickly and it is an awesome way to practice your values.
